nx_food_recipe_gate.nx -- GATE: R-RECIPE. Mines the license-clean fetched corpora for ingredient
co-occurrence, validates the signal recovers the classic seeded pairings (research, not bro science),
and promotes the learned pairings into the durable store. Proves: T1 corpora mined, T2 LICENSE-GATED
mining (an inadmissible-tagged corpus is REFUSED -- negative control), T3 real signal found, T4 measured
validation (>=3 of the 15 seeded classic pairs independently confirmed by real recipe text; concrete
allium pairs printed), T5 promotion durable + readable, T6 facts-only (learned value is a bare count, no
prose). license_tier: ORIGINAL
